When you run the simulation, a window should pop up with three buttons
that say "return to input building description" or "view summary
results/reports" or "view detailed simulation output file." The first
option returns you to the model, the second shows you a bar graph with
electricity usage, and the third shows you the couple thousand page
report that you're probably looking for.

On a related note, I remember a question about running baseline & proposed
in the same model. Originally, I was thinking the similarly to the answer
that was given - there has to be 2 models, but I just set up a model with 2
HVAC systems (1 geothermal to cover perimeter & 1 PSZ to cover the one core
zone that is actually gas & electric heat, but 90.1G seems to tell me to
assign PSZ).

First in the building wizard, I assigned these systems as described above.
Then, while in the EEM run wizard, I created a new run and called it "Whole
Building EEM Baseline". I went to the run details of that one and deleted
the geothermal systems and assigned the PSZ to all zones. Went back into
the first Whole Building EEM & the geothermal was still there assigned to
perimeter zones so long story short, I think I am running a "baseline case"
& a proposed in the same model.

Some of the reports show a case just called "baseline" as well, but I'm
thinking I can ignore that one so I can get the results I need side-by-side.
